Know The Room: Dating Lesbian Personals With Respect

Start by remembering that "lesbian personals" describes a dating context, not a full identity. People use this category to meet others for friendship, casual dates, or long-term relationships — and their reasons can vary. Approach conversations with curiosity, not assumptions.

Set clear intentions. Briefly say what you’re looking for in your profile or opening message (friendship, dating, something casual). Clear intentions help others decide quickly if you want the same things and reduce misunderstandings.

Avoid assumptions. Don’t assume someone’s relationship history, labels, or level of outness. If a personal detail matters to you, ask respectfully rather than assuming: simple, open questions show interest without prying.

Use respectful language. Use the name and pronouns someone shares. If you aren’t sure, it’s okay to use neutral language or politely ask how they prefer to be addressed. Avoid slang or terms that could feel diminishing.

Listen more than you tell. Give space for people to share what’s important to them. Reflect back what you hear and ask follow-up questions that show you’re paying attention, such as asking about hobbies, values, or how they like to spend weekends.

Be mindful of safety and privacy. Some people may be cautious about what they share publicly. Respect boundaries around photos, social media, or personal stories. Move sensitive topics to private messages only after you’ve built trust.

Skip stereotypes and generalizations. Don’t assume appearance, behavior, or life goals map directly to someone’s orientation. Treat each profile as an individual, and focus on shared interests and mutual respect.

Show genuine interest. Mention something specific from their profile; short, specific messages stand out more than generic compliments. Offer a clear next step if things go well, like suggesting a coffee, a walk, or a low-pressure activity you both enjoy.

Dating Confidence Reset

Start by clarifying what you want. Write down one to three priorities for your dating right now — for example, meeting new people, practicing conversation skills, or finding a low-pressure date. Keeping your goals specific makes it easier to say yes or no to profiles and messages without overthinking.

Slow the pace and protect your energy. Treat early chats as low-stakes information gathering: ask a couple of clear questions, share a simple detail about yourself, and pause to notice how the conversation feels. If it drains you or stalls repeatedly, step back. If it flows with curiosity and respect, keep going.

Manage expectations by focusing on small signs of progress rather than instant chemistry. A thoughtful reply, a shared laugh, or someone who respects boundaries are wins. Track these micro-progresses so you can see momentum even when matches don’t turn into dates right away.

Choose matches thoughtfully. Before swiping or messaging, glance at profiles for a few red flags and a few green flags — compatible habits, clear intent, or interests you actually enjoy. Favor people who state what they want and show basic courtesy; this saves time and reduces repeated disappointment.

Keep your emotional steadiness by setting limits and rituals. Decide how much time you’ll spend on the app each day or week, and build a short routine for signing off (stretch, step outside, do one pleasant task). That structure prevents burnout and keeps dating part of life, not your life.

Be kind to yourself after rejection or quiet matches. Replace “what’s wrong with me” with practical questions: Did I communicate clearly? Was my timing off? What will I try differently next time? These small adjustments keep you improving without eroding self-worth.
